"Brendan Jurd" <direvus@gmail.com> writes:
> If I read Greg's latter proposal correctly, he was suggesting

> \df Lists all user functions
> \df [pattern] Lists both system and user functions matching [pattern]
> \df * Lists all system and user functions

Hmm, I must've misread it, because I didn't understand it quite like
that.  That seems like a nice simple minimal-featuritis approach.

One question: should \df really list *all* nonsystem functions?  Or just
the ones that are visible in your search path?  I'd be inclined to say
the second.
